Transaction 13ec7f6d8217ed8270586251906e66cd04370713e21ed8e3add41d985b2ce29e
1 Input
1 Output
-
13ec7f6d8217ed8270586251906e66cd04370713e21ed8e3add41d985b2ce29e:0
- value
- 70068877
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5d50b1123a9e8a54624c5cd796cc0e45a8bde2e OP_EQUAL
- address
- MRwCZiwYDEE8rBEygkSemKPxECL56qh7gG